A fire tube boiler is a boiler system that heats water by passing hot gases through tubes immersed in water, generating steam. firetube boilers are a popular type of boiler in industrial and commercial settings for generating steam or hot water. a fire tube boiler is a type of boiler in which hot gases pass from a fire through one or more tubes running through a sealed. Includes the furnace for burning fuel, fire tubes for passing gases, and a steam dome for collecting steam. This procedure efficiently transmits the heat from the hot gas to the water, which efficiently produces steam. fire tube boilers, also known as smoke tube boilers, are the most common type of industrial boiler employed today. fire tube boiler definition:
